Praxis Investment Management Inc. Purchases Shares of 2,960 SouthState Co. (NASDAQ:SSB)

SouthState logo with Finance background

Praxis Investment Management Inc. bought a new stake in SouthState Co. (NASDAQ:SSB - Free Report) during the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und bought 2,960 shares of the bank's stock, valued at approximately $275,000.

Other hedge funds also recently bought and sold shares of the company. Sanctuary Advisors LLC grew its stake in shares of SouthState by 38.8% in the 4th quarter. Sanctuary Advisors LLC now owns 3,782 shares of the bank's stock valued at $401,000 after buying an additional 1,057 shares in the last quarter. CIBC Asset Management Inc lifted its stake in SouthState by 5.7% in the fourth quarter. CIBC Asset Management Inc now owns 2,324 shares of the bank's stock valued at $231,000 after acquiring an additional 126 shares during the last quarter. Handelsbanken Fonder AB grew its position in SouthState by 13.8% in the fourth quarter. Handelsbanken Fonder AB now owns 18,958 shares of the bank's stock worth $1,886,000 after acquiring an additional 2,300 shares in the last quarter. Bank of New York Mellon Corp grew its position in SouthState by 4.7% in the fourth quarter. Bank of New York Mellon Corp now owns 842,498 shares of the bank's stock worth $83,812,000 after acquiring an additional 37,796 shares in the last quarter. Finally, FourThought Financial Partners LLC acquired a new position in shares of SouthState during the 4th quarter worth $289,000. 89.76% of the stock is owned by institutional investors and hedge funds.

Analyst Upgrades and Downgrades

Several research firms recently issued reports on SSB. Barclays reduced their price objective on shares of SouthState from $120.00 to $115.00 and set an "overweight" rating for the company in a research note on Tuesday, April 8th. Keefe, Bruyette & Woods reduced their price target on SouthState from $130.00 to $120.00 and set an "outperform" rating for the company in a research report on Tuesday, May 6th. Stephens reiterated an "overweight" rating and set a $119.00 price target on shares of SouthState in a research note on Monday, April 28th. DA Davidson lowered their price objective on SouthState from $125.00 to $115.00 and set a "buy" rating on the stock in a report on Monday, April 28th. Finally, Truist Financial began coverage on SouthState in a research note on Tuesday, May 13th. They issued a "buy" rating and a $106.00 price objective on the stock. One equities research analyst has rated the stock with a hold rating, eight have assigned a buy rating and two have assigned a strong buy rating to the company's stock. According to MarketBeat.com, the stock has an average rating of "Buy" and a consensus price target of $116.27.

SouthState Stock Performance

Shares of NASDAQ SSB traded up $3.11 during trading hours on Thursday, hitting $91.94. 975,806 shares of the company's st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 675,799. The company's 50-day moving average price is $88.42 and its 200-day moving average price is $94.14. SouthState Co. has a 1-year low of $72.97 and a 1-year high of $114.27. The stock has a market capitalization of $9.33 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 13.21 and a beta of 0.77.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.07, a current ratio of 0.91 and a quick ratio of 0.91.

SouthState Dividend Announcement

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, May 16th. Shareholders of record on Friday, May 9th were given a $0.54 dividend. The ex-dividend date was Friday, May 9th. This represents a $2.16 annualized dividend and a yield of 2.35%. SouthState's dividend payout ratio is 34.12%.

SouthState Company Profile

SouthState Corporation operates as the bank holding company for SouthState Bank, National Association that provides a range of banking services and products to individuals and companies. It offers checking accounts, savings deposits, interest-bearing transaction accounts, certificates of deposits, money market accounts, and other time deposits, as well as bond accounting, asset/liability consulting related activities, and other clearing and corporate checking account services.
